Comprehensive Guide to Louisiana Subpoena
What is the Louisiana Subpoena for Deposition and Subpoena Duces Tecum?
The Louisiana Subpoena for Deposition and Subpoena Duces Tecum serves as a crucial legal document in the state, necessary for compelling individuals to provide testimony or produce documents in court. A subpoena for deposition specifically requires a witness to appear for questioning, while a subpoena duces tecum mandates the submission of documents related to the case. These legal tools empower attorneys to ensure the thoroughness of their case by securing necessary evidence and testimonies, which are fundamental for effective litigation.

Key Features of the Louisiana Subpoena for Deposition and Subpoena Duces Tecum
This legal document features a structured layout that includes essential fillable fields necessary for its valid deployment. Important sections contain prompts such as "YOU ARE HEREBY COMMANDED to appear at the office of" and a designated area for inputting the docket number and appearance date. Additionally, compliance checkboxes allow users to confirm adherence to submission requirements, ensuring all legal bases are covered. Users will also find reference to the lwc-wc-1006a form crucial for the workers' compensation context.

Who is eligible to use the Louisiana Subpoena?
Attorneys and legal representatives in Louisiana are primarily eligible to use this subpoena form. Additionally, any party needing to compel a witness or document production in court can utilize this document as authorized.
Are there deadlines associated with submitting this subpoena?
While specific deadlines may vary based on the court's schedule, it is crucial to serve the subpoena in a timely manner to ensure that the witness can adequately prepare for the scheduled court appearance.
What is the process for submitting the Louisiana Subpoena?
The Louisiana Subpoena must be signed by the Office of Workers’ Compensation and served to all attorneys of record. You can submit it by hand delivery, mail, or electronically if permitted by the court rules.

Can this form be notarized?
No, the Louisiana Subpoena for Deposition and Subpoena Duces Tecum does not require notarization. However, ensuring the form is signed by the appropriate office is essential for its validity.
